远程过程调用(remoteprocedurecall,简称rpc)是一种常见的跨网络通信机制,它允许在不同进程或不同计算机上的程序之间进行通信和数据交换。然而,在某些情况下,使用rpc可能会出现失败并导致闪屏问题的情况。
一、原因分析
1.网络连接问题:网络连接不稳定或中断可能导致远程过程调用失败。
2.服务器负载过高:如果服务器负载过高,可能无法处理所有的远程过程调用请求,从而导致部分调用失败。
3.错误的调用参数:错误的调用参数可能导致远程过程调用失败或返回意外结果。
4.安全设置问题:某些安全设置可能会限制远程过程调用的执行,从而导致失败或闪屏现象。
二、解决方法
1.检查网络连接:确保网络连接稳定并没有中断。可以尝试重新连接网络或重启路由器来恢复稳定的网络连接。
2.优化服务器负载:如果服务器负载过高,可以通过增加服务器的处理能力或优化代码来减轻负载压力。
3.检查调用参数:确保调用参数正确无误。可以检查参数的类型、范围和格式是否符合要求。
4.调整安全设置:如果存在安全设置限制,可以根据实际需求适当调整安全级别或权限设置。
总结:
通过以上解决方法,可以有效解决远程过程调用失败且未执行还闪屏的问题。在实际应用中,需要仔细分析具体情况并选择合适的解决方法。同时,及时备份重要数据,以防止数据丢失或异常情况发生。最后,建议定期更新软件和系统,以获取最新的修复和改进措施。
参考文献:
[1]microsoftdocs.remoteprocedurecall[db/ol].availablefrom:
原文标题:远程过程调用失败且未执行还闪屏 解决远程过程调用失败,如若转载,请注明出处:https://www.shcrbfchs.com/tag/4294.html
免责声明:此资讯系转载自合作媒体或互联网其它网站,「泰福润金」登载此文出于传递更多信息之目的,并不意味着赞同其观点或证实其描述,文章内容仅供参考。